Curriculum Modernization and Skill Integration

Curricula need to be dynamic, regularly updated to reflect current industry trends and technological advancements. This means moving beyond static textbooks and incorporating real-world case studies, project-based learning, and hands-on training. A crucial aspect is the integration of practical skills directly into the degree programs, rather than treating them as optional add-ons. This ensures that every student graduates with a foundational set of competencies relevant to their chosen field. For instance, engineering programs should embed coding bootcamps or data analytics modules, while business programs might include digital marketing or supply chain management workshops as core components. This approach ensures that students are not just learning theory but are actively applying it in practical scenarios, making them more attractive to employers.

Fostering Strong Industry Partnerships

Collaboration with industry is not just beneficial; it's essential. Colleges need to build and maintain strong, symbiotic relationships with companies. This can manifest in various ways: guest lectures by industry professionals, internships and co-op programs, joint research projects, and advisory boards composed of industry experts who provide feedback on curriculum relevance. Such partnerships offer students invaluable exposure to the professional world, mentorship opportunities, and a clearer understanding of career paths. For colleges, these collaborations ensure that their programs remain aligned with industry needs and can lead to enhanced placement opportunities for their graduates. A proactive approach to such collaborations is vital for staying ahead.

Developing Outcome-Based Education (OBE)

Outcome-based education shifts the focus from simply teaching to ensuring that students achieve specific learning outcomes. This involves clearly defining what students should know, understand, and be able to do upon completion of a course or program. Assessment methods are then designed to measure the achievement of these outcomes, providing a clear picture of student competency. This approach ensures accountability and allows for continuous improvement of teaching and learning processes. By focusing on measurable results, colleges can better demonstrate the value of their programs to students, parents, and potential employers. This structured approach to learning is fundamental to creating graduates who are demonstrably capable.

Assessing and Measuring Employability

Ultimately, the success of an industry-ready college is measured by the employability of its graduates. Colleges should implement robust career services, including resume building workshops, interview preparation, and networking events. Tracking placement rates, graduate salaries, and employer feedback provides valuable data for continuous improvement. A focus on measurable student outcomes ensures that the institution is effectively meeting its objectives and producing graduates who are well-prepared for their chosen careers. This feedback loop is crucial for maintaining relevance and excellence in higher education.
